

Rainer Koschke, Visualization of Software-Clone Data: A Comprehensive Survey (joint with VISSOFT) (Session Chair: Chanchal Roy, Location: Burlington Room) An Exploratory Study on Automatic Architectural Change Analysis Using Natural Language Processing Techniques

#Jack visoft code#
Behave Nicely! Automatic Generation of Code for Behaviour Driven Development Test Suites The Strengths and Behavioral Quirks of Java Bytecode Decompilers Nicolas Harrand, César Soto-Valero, Martin Monperrus and Benoit Baudry.
#Jack visoft software#
Toward Optimal Selection of Information Retrieval Models for Software Engineering Tasks
#Jack visoft for android#
Introducing Privacy in Screen Event Frequency Analysis for Android Apps Hailong Zhang, Sufian Latif, Raef Bassily and Atanas Rountev.Permission Issues in Open-source Android Apps: An Exploratory Study Gian Luca Scoccia, Anthony Peruma, Virginia Pujols, Ivano Malavolta and Daniel Krutz.Automatically Generating Fix Suggestions in Response to Static Code Analysis Warnings Furia, Rodrigo Bonifacio and Gustavo Pinto. On The Quality of Identifiers in Test Code Bin Lin, Csaba Nagy, Gabriele Bavota, Andrian Marcus and Michele Lanza.Contextualizing Rename Decisions using Refactorings and Commit Messages Anthony Peruma, Mohamed Wiem Mkaouer, Michael J.Towards constructing the SSA form using reaching definitions over dominance frontiers Abu Naser Masud and Federico Ciccozzi.LUDroid: A Large Scale Analysis of Android - Web Hybridization Abhishek Tiwari, Jyoti Prakash, Sascha Groß and Christian Hammer.Please check back later for updates, and follow us on Twitter to keep informed. Steering Committee Charter Shared Keynote with VISSOFT Rainer Koschke Visualization of Software-Clone Data: A Comprehensive Survey The term ‘manipulation’ is taken to mean any automated or semi-automated procedure which takes and returns source code. The term ‘analysis’ is taken to mean any automated or semi automated procedure which takes source code and yields insight into its meaning. It is therefore so-construed as to include machine code, very high level languages and executable graphical representations of systems. Definition of ‘Source Code’įor the purpose of clarity ‘source code’ is taken to mean any fully executable description of a software system. The analysis and manipulation of source code Is properly directed towards other aspects of systemsĭevelopment and evolution, such as specification, designĪnd requirements engineering, it is the source code thatĬontains the only precise description of the behaviour of

Much attention in the wider software engineering community Manipulation of the source code of computer systems. Techniques and applications which concern analysis and/or Researchers and practitioners working on theory, The aim of the International Working Conference on SourceĬode Analysis & Manipulation (SCAM) is to bring together SCAM 2019 will be held in Cleveland, OH, USA co-located with ICSME 2019.
